Why Graphics Driver Updates Actually Matter For Your Gaming Performance

Fresh GPU drivers aren’t just about fixing bugs – they’re performance goldmines. Modern game releases often see frame rate improvements ranging from 5% to 20% with day-one driver optimizations. When developers and GPU manufacturers work together, they fine-tune how your graphics card handles specific game engines and rendering techniques.

Beyond raw FPS gains, updated drivers bring critical security patches that protect your system from vulnerabilities. Hackers actively target outdated graphics drivers because they operate at a deep system level. One compromised driver could give attackers serious control over your entire PC.

Red Flags: When You Should NOT Update Your GPU Drivers

Hold your horses! Not every driver release deserves an immediate download. The gaming community has learned some hard lessons about blindly updating to the latest version.

If your system is running smooth as butter and your games are performing flawlessly, you might want to stick with what works. New drivers sometimes introduce unexpected issues that weren’t present in previous versions.

Skip the Update If This Applies to You

Smart gamers wait about a week after major driver releases to see how the community responds. Reddit and gaming forums quickly reveal if a driver version causes black screens, crashes, or performance regressions. Patience saves you from becoming a beta tester for buggy software.

The Golden Version Strategy

Many experienced users identify a “golden version” – that sweet spot driver that runs perfectly with their specific hardware configuration. They stick with it for months, only updating when absolutely necessary for new game releases or critical security patches. There’s zero shame in this approach. Stability beats having the latest version number every single time.

Essential Pre-Update Preparation Steps

Taking ten minutes to prepare properly can save you hours of troubleshooting headaches. These preparation steps give you multiple safety nets if something goes sideways during the update process.

Document Your Current Configuration

Open Device Manager by right-clicking the Start button, expand Display Adapters, right-click your graphics card, select Properties, and note the exact driver version number under the Driver tab. Screenshot this for reference. Also write down your current performance in a game you play regularly – knowing your baseline FPS helps you verify the update actually improved things.

Create System Restore Point

Windows System Restore is your emergency ejection seat. Type “Create a restore point” in the Windows search bar, click Create, give it a descriptive name like “Before GPU Driver Update”, and let Windows work its magic. This takes just minutes but gives you a quick rollback option if the new driver causes problems.

Clear the Deck

Close all running programs, especially monitoring software like MSI Afterburner, RGB control apps, and any overclocking utilities. Temporarily disable your antivirus during installation – sometimes security software interferes with driver updates. You can re-enable it immediately after the installation completes.

Step-by-Step Safe Installation Methods

You’ve got two solid approaches for installing GPU drivers. The standard method works great for routine updates, while the nuclear option solves persistent problems.

Method One: Clean Installation Through Official Installer

This straightforward approach handles most situations perfectly. Right-click your downloaded driver file and select “Run as administrator” to launch the installer with proper permissions.

When the installation wizard appears, choose Custom installation instead of Express. This gives you control over the process. On the next screen, check the box labeled “Perform a clean installation” – this crucial option removes old driver files that sometimes cause conflicts.

You’ll see checkboxes for additional components like GeForce Experience, PhysX, and audio drivers. GeForce Experience adds overlay features and automatic update notifications, but it’s optional if you prefer a leaner installation. Uncheck anything you don’t need.

Click Install and let the process run. Your screen might flicker or go black briefly – this is completely normal as the driver switches over. The installation typically takes five to ten minutes. Don’t interrupt it or turn off your computer during this phase.

After completion, restart your computer even if the installer doesn’t demand it. A fresh boot ensures all driver components load properly.

Method Two: DDU Clean Sweep For Problem Solving

When you’re experiencing persistent issues or switching between GPU brands, Display Driver Uninstaller becomes your best friend. This free tool completely removes every trace of graphics drivers, giving you a truly clean slate.

Preparing For DDU

Download DDU from its official website and extract the archive. Disconnect your internet connection – this prevents Windows from automatically installing generic drivers during the cleaning process. You can disable your network adapter through Windows settings or simply unplug your ethernet cable and turn off WiFi.

Booting Into Safe Mode

Press Windows Key plus R, type “msconfig”, and hit Enter. Navigate to the Boot tab, check Safe Boot, select Minimal, and click Apply. Restart your computer to enter Safe Mode where Windows loads only essential services.

Running The Cleaner

Launch DDU in Safe Mode. Select your GPU manufacturer from the dropdown menu, choose “Clean and restart” from the options, and let DDU work its magic. The tool removes driver files, registry entries, and cached data that standard uninstallers miss.

After the automatic restart, your computer boots back into normal mode with completely removed graphics drivers. Now reconnect your internet and run your freshly downloaded driver installer following the clean installation steps from Method One.

Post-Installation Testing and Verification

Installing the driver is only half the battle. Proper testing confirms everything works correctly before you jump into competitive matches or important gaming sessions.

Verify Driver Version

Open NVIDIA Control Panel or AMD Radeon Software and check the System Information section. Confirm the version number matches what you just installed. While you’re there, glance through the settings to ensure your preferences carried over correctly.

Run Benchmark Tests

Fire up a benchmarking tool like 3DMark or Unigine Heaven. Run the same test you performed before updating and compare scores. You should see improvements or at minimum, identical performance. Any significant drops indicate something went wrong.

Test Your Favorite Games

Launch the games you play most frequently and check for visual glitches, stuttering, or crashes. Monitor your frame rates and temperatures using tools like MSI Afterburner or GPU-Z. Everything should run as smoothly or better than before.

Pay special attention during the first few hours of gaming. Some issues only appear after extended play sessions when components heat up. If you notice problems, document exactly what’s happening so you can troubleshoot effectively.

Emergency Rollback Procedures When Things Go Wrong

Even with perfect preparation, occasional driver updates just don’t play nice with specific hardware configurations. Having rollback options ready keeps you gaming instead of troubleshooting for hours.

Quick Rollback Through Device Manager

If you can still boot into Windows normally, Device Manager offers the fastest rollback method. Open Device Manager, expand Display Adapters, right-click your GPU, select Properties, switch to the Driver tab, and click Roll Back Driver. Windows reinstalls the previous version automatically.

Keep an offline copy of your last working driver installer on your hard drive. Internet access might be unavailable if display driver problems prevent proper system booting.

System Restore For Severe Problems

When you’re facing black screens or boot loops, System Restore becomes your lifeline. Boot into Safe Mode using the same process described earlier, search for System Restore in the Start menu, select your pre-update restore point, and let Windows rewind your system to its previous state.

Nuclear Option: DDU in Safe Mode

For catastrophic failures where nothing else works, boot into Safe Mode, run DDU to completely remove the problematic drivers, and install your previous known-good driver version. This scorched-earth approach solves nearly any driver-related disaster.

Advanced Tips For Maximum Stability

Once you’ve mastered basic driver management, these advanced strategies help you maintain peak performance while minimizing risk.

Strategic Update Timing

Schedule driver updates during times when you don’t need your computer. Weekend mornings work great – if something breaks, you have time to troubleshoot without missing work or important gaming sessions. Never update right before tournaments, streaming sessions, or deadlines.

Monitor Community Feedback

Gaming communities on Reddit and forums serve as early warning systems. Search for the driver version number plus “issues” or “problems” before installing. If multiple users report crashes or performance drops with your specific GPU model, wait for the next release.

Laptop-Specific Considerations

Gaming laptop owners should prioritize manufacturer-provided drivers over generic GPU manufacturer versions. Dell, ASUS, MSI, and other laptop makers customize drivers for their specific cooling solutions and power delivery systems. Generic drivers sometimes cause thermal throttling or battery drain issues that OEM versions avoid.

Monitoring Tools For Peace of Mind

Install GPU monitoring software to track temperatures, clock speeds, and fan behavior. Unusual patterns after driver updates can indicate problems before they cause crashes. Tools like HWiNFO64 provide detailed logging that helps diagnose subtle issues.

Understanding Driver Types and Which You Need

Not all drivers serve the same purpose. Choosing the right type for your use case prevents unnecessary problems.

Game Ready vs Studio Drivers

NVIDIA offers two driver branches. Game Ready drivers prioritize gaming performance and include day-one optimizations for new releases. Studio drivers focus on stability for content creators using programs like Adobe Premiere or Blender. Gamers should default to Game Ready unless they primarily use their GPU for professional creative work.

WHQL vs Beta Drivers

WHQL-certified drivers passed Microsoft’s testing process, offering maximum stability. Beta drivers include cutting-edge features and optimizations but skip extensive testing. Competitive gamers and professionals should stick with WHQL releases, while enthusiasts comfortable with troubleshooting can experiment with betas.

Automating Updates Safely

GeForce Experience and AMD Adrenalin software offer automatic driver updates. These tools work fine for casual users who want convenience, but they remove your control over timing and version selection.

If you enable automatic updates, configure the software to notify you about new drivers rather than installing them immediately. This preserves the convenience while letting you check community feedback before committing to the update.

Windows Update also installs generic display drivers automatically. Disable this feature through Group Policy Editor or Registry edits to prevent Windows from overwriting your carefully chosen driver versions with potentially incompatible alternatives.

Frequently Asked Questions About GPU Driver Updates

How often should I update my graphics card drivers?

Update your GPU drivers when new games release that you plan to play, when security vulnerabilities get patched, or when you experience performance issues. For stable systems running older games, updating every three to six months is sufficient. Quality matters more than frequency.

Can outdated graphics drivers damage my GPU?

Outdated drivers won’t physically damage your graphics card, but they can cause inefficient power management leading to higher temperatures and electricity consumption. The bigger risks are security vulnerabilities, performance losses, and compatibility issues with new games.

What should I do if my screen goes black after updating drivers?

Force restart your computer by holding the power button. Boot into Safe Mode by repeatedly pressing F8 during startup. Once in Safe Mode, use DDU to remove the problematic driver completely, then install your previous working driver version from an offline installer.

Is it safe to skip driver versions?

Absolutely safe and often recommended. You can jump from very old drivers straight to the latest version without installing intermediate releases. The clean installation option ensures all necessary files get updated properly regardless of how many versions you skip.

Should laptop users install drivers from NVIDIA or AMD directly?

Laptop users should first check their laptop manufacturer’s website for customized drivers optimized for their specific model. These OEM drivers account for unique thermal designs and power configurations. Only use generic GPU manufacturer drivers if your laptop maker hasn’t released updates recently.

Do I need to uninstall old drivers before installing new ones?

Modern driver installers include clean installation options that remove old files automatically. Manual uninstallation isn’t necessary for routine updates. However, when troubleshooting problems or switching GPU brands, using DDU to completely remove previous drivers prevents conflicts.

Will updating drivers improve FPS in all games?

Driver updates typically improve performance in newly released games through specific optimizations, but older games might see minimal gains. Performance improvements range from negligible to 20% depending on the game, your hardware, and how outdated your previous drivers were.
